A WebRTC transport with direct p2p communication (without a STUN server).
Implementations§
Source§impl Transport
impl Transport
Sourcepub fn new(id_keys: Keypair, certificate: Certificate) -> Self
pub fn new(id_keys: Keypair, certificate: Certificate) -> Self
Creates a new WebRTC transport.
§Example
use libp2p_identity as identity;
use libp2p_webrtc::tokio::{Certificate, Transport};
use rand::thread_rng;
let id_keys = identity::Keypair::generate_ed25519();
let transport = Transport::new(id_keys, Certificate::generate(&mut thread_rng()).unwrap());Trait Implementations§
